OriginMid 19th century; earliest use found in William Barnes (1801–1886), poet and philologist. From classical Latin abesse to be absent, to be away, to be elsewhere, to be distant + -ive. Definition of abessive in US English:abessiveadjectiveəˈbɛsɪv Grammar
